Job Title: International Shipping CoordinatorJob Description

The International Shipping Coordinator is responsible for managing tasks related to the shipment and receiving of materials, supplies, and equipment in a manufacturing environment. This role involves preparing goods for shipment, maintaining accurate records of goods shipped, and handling bills of lading. The coordinator will also compare identifying information on outgoing shipments against bills of lading, invoices, orders, or other records, and post weight and shipping charges while maintaining shipping record files. The ability to operate warehouse equipment, such as pallet jacks and forklifts, is essential.
